Under direct supervision, the Patient Financial Advisor (PFA) is a professional responsible for identifying appropriate financial sponsorship for members and non-members and determining their cost share obligation. This requires the following: 1) Accurate and timely assessment of payer and patient liability; 2) Compliance with federal, state and local regulations; 3) Effective communication with patients regarding personal payment liabilities and options for meeting those obligations. The PFA must create a positive customer experience for all patients through personalized care.
